2007 Daihatsu Sirion vs. 2000 Mazda 121
To start off, 2007 Daihatsu Sirion is newer by 7 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 2000 Mazda 121.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 2000 Mazda 121 would be higher. Both 2007 Daihatsu Sirion and 2000 Mazda 121 are equipped with a 1,298 cc engine. In terms of performance, 2007 Daihatsu Sirion (86 HP @ 6000 RPM) has 27 more horse power than 2000 Mazda 121. (59 HP @ 5000 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2007 Daihatsu Sirion should accelerate faster than 2000 Mazda 121.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2000 Mazda 121 weights approximately 5 kg more than 2007 Daihatsu Sirion.
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2007 Daihatsu Sirion (120 Nm @ 3200 RPM) has 15 more torque (in Nm) than 2000 Mazda 121. (105 Nm @ 2500 RPM). This means 2007 Daihatsu Sirion will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2000 Mazda 121.
